  1. 1. Any person who never saw his father can cure it, by giving the patient a drink from a river running between two town lands.
    2. A married pair, the wife whose maiden name is the same as her husband's takes the child who is suffering from the chin-cough and puts it from one to another under and over a she ass in the Name of the Father, etc.
    The child is given three sips of the ass's milk to drink, or a small piece of bread and jam to eat and it must leave no leavings.
